Descripción
In a clever and incisive exploration, a trio of authors delve into the world of self-help with a critical eye, targeting the genre's myriad forms and the cultural phenomena surrounding them. Through a blend of humor and intellect, they dissect the underlying messages often found in self-help literature, revealing the absurdities and contradictions that lie beneath the surface.
As they navigate this landscape, the authors invite readers to reconsider what it means to seek improvement and the ways in which such aspirations can be manipulated. Their sharp observations challenge conventional wisdom, making for a thought-provoking read that balances wit with a deep understanding of societal expectations. This examination is both an entertaining critique and a reflective commentary on the human desire for self-betterment.
